The Role Of Commercial Electrical Engineers

commercial electrical engineers play a critical role in designing, installing, and maintaining electrical systems in commercial buildings. From office complexes to retail stores, these professionals ensure that electrical systems are safe, efficient, and compliant with building codes. In this article, we will explore the responsibilities and skills required of commercial electrical engineers, as well as the importance of their work in the modern business world.

commercial electrical engineers are responsible for designing electrical systems that meet the specific needs of commercial buildings. This includes developing layouts for lighting, power distribution, and communication systems. They must also consider factors such as energy efficiency, safety, and reliability when designing these systems. In addition, commercial electrical engineers must stay up-to-date on building codes and regulations to ensure that their designs comply with local and national standards.

Once a design is finalized, commercial electrical engineers oversee the installation of electrical systems in commercial buildings. This involves working closely with construction teams to ensure that electrical components are installed correctly and safely. commercial electrical engineers must also make sure that all installations meet the specifications outlined in the design plans. They may also be responsible for testing and troubleshooting electrical systems to ensure that they are functioning properly.

In addition to design and installation, commercial electrical engineers are also responsible for maintaining and repairing electrical systems in commercial buildings. This includes conducting routine inspections to identify and address any issues before they become major problems. Commercial electrical engineers must also respond quickly to any outages or malfunctions to minimize downtime for businesses. This requires a combination of technical expertise and problem-solving skills to diagnose and resolve electrical issues efficiently.

To be successful as a commercial electrical engineer, individuals must possess a variety of skills and qualifications. A strong background in electrical engineering is essential, as is a thorough understanding of building codes and regulations. Commercial electrical engineers must also have excellent communication skills to work effectively with clients, contractors, and other team members. Attention to detail and problem-solving abilities are also important traits for commercial electrical engineers, as they often encounter complex challenges in their work.
